    The impression I got from the statements in the magazine was that they'd be carving each massive region into about three sections and making each section more unique. So now we have the Black Shroud and in it is the South Shroud, North Shroud, West Shroud, etc. and they all look extremely similar - we see them all as just one massive area. But they would change it so that the Black Shroud is just a region, and individual areas within all look unique.

    The extent they change it is the real question though. Are they still going to use all the same textures but just have a layout redesign? Are they going to keep the areas the same but just color them with new textures and add landmarks to give them a different appearance? Or are they really going to replace one massive area with 3-4 smaller ones that have entirely new models and textures? That's what I would like to know
    for when I try and use it to hype the game to friends.
